Moving DS into new daycare room before or after LO

We're due with number two a month from Saturday.  DS will be 21 months in a few days.  Daycare has suggested moving him into the two year old room starting next week.  We're not sure what would be best.  On one hand he's doing really well in his current room and he has some time before he's actually two.  On the other hand we think it may be good to have him go through the transition before our LO gets here so that he's settled into the room by then.  We weren't sure if moving him in a few months, when our new LO is also a few months old, would be more of transition because things are different at home as well.

  • If I could choose, I would have DD move up before the baby gets here. I think it will take her less time getting used to her new room and teacher in DC than getting used to her new brother or sister. Unfortunately, that is not up to me and she'll be switching rooms when the baby is a month old at the most.

    If all the kids moving up rooms at the same time (that's how it is at our DC), I am thinking it will make the transition easier/faster on your DS as he will keep his friends with him.
